Connecting the Camera to a TV, Printer, or Computer
Transferring Images to a Computer (ViewNX-i)
Installing ViewNX-i
ViewNX-i is Nikon software that enables you to transfer images and movies to your
computer for viewing and editing.
To install ViewNX-i, download the latest version of the ViewNX-i installer from the
following website and follow the on-screen instructions to complete installation.
https://downloadcenter.nikonimglib.com
For system requirements and other information, see the Nikon website for your
region.
Transferring Images to a Computer
The items displayed on your computer screen may change when you update the
version of your operating system or software.
1 Prepare a memory card that contains images.
You can use any of the methods below to transfer images from the memory card to a
computer.
SD memory card slot/card reader: Insert the memory card into the card slot of
your computer or the card reader (commercially available) that is connected to the
computer.
Direct USB connection: Turn the camera off and ensure that the memory card is
inserted in the camera. Connect the camera to the computer using the USB cable.
The camera automatically turns on.
To transfer images that are saved in the camera’s internal memory, remove the
memory card from the camera before connecting it to the computer.
B Notes About Connecting the Camera to a Computer
Disconnect all other USB-powered devices from the computer. Connecting the
camera and other USB-powered devices to the same computer simultaneously may
cause a camera malfunction or excessive power supply from the computer, which
could damage the camera or memory card.

Nikon Coolpix A1000 Specifications

General IconGeneral
TypeCompact digital camera
Sensor Type1/2.3-in. type CMOS
Effective Pixels16.0 million
LensNIKKOR lens with 35x optical zoom
Aperturef/3.4-6.9
Lens Construction13 elements in 11 groups (4 ED lens elements)
Autofocus SystemContrast-detect AF
Monitor TypeTFT LCD with Anti-reflection coating
Storage MediaSD, SDHC, SDXC memory cards
Digital Zoom Magnification4x
Vibration ReductionLens-shift VR (still images), Lens shift and electronic VR (movies)
Focus Range[W]: Approx. 50 cm (1 ft 8 in.) to infinity, [T]: Approx. 2.0 m (6 ft 7 in.) to infinity
Monitor Size3.0-inch tilting TFT LCD
Monitor ResolutionApprox. 1, 036, 800 dots
Movie4K UHD (3840 x 2160) at 30p, Full HD (1920 x 1080) at 60p
ISO SensitivityISO 100 to 1600
Shutter Speed1/2000 to 1 s
Exposure Compensation-2 to +2 EV in increments of 1/3 EV
Power SourcesEN-EL12 Rechargeable Li-ion Battery
Battery LifeApprox. 250 shots when using EN-EL12 battery
DimensionsApprox. 114.2 x 71.7 x 40.5 mm (4.5 x 2.9 x 1.6 in.)
WeightApprox. 330 g (11.7 oz) (including battery and memory card)
ConnectivityBluetooth, Wi-Fi
Continuous ShootingApprox. 7 fps at full resolution
Focal Length4.3-150.5mm (35mm equivalent: 24-840mm)
